The Silent Sister by Diane Chamberlain

352 pages first pub 2014 (editions)

fiction mystery thriller emotional mysterious medium-paced

Description

In The Silent Sister, Riley MacPherson has spent her entire life believing that her older sister Lisa committed suicide as a teenager. Now, over twenty years later, her father has passed away and she's in New Bern, North Carolina cleaning out his ...
